I'm one episode away from finishing Danganronpa 3: Despair. I've been having an odd sort of experience watching it--I started out watching the English dub because of having experienced the game in English, but they replaced the most distinctive voice actors for the anime. Gundham's okay once you get used to the change, but Fuyuhiko and Ibuki are just...ugh. Ibuki doesn't even sound like the same kind of character. And all three were some of my favorite characters in the game, which just makes it more obvious. So, halfway through, I switched to the Japanese. It's funny how changing all the voices is less irritating than only changing some. :P

Once I'm finished with that, I'm going to binge the new season of Blue Exorcist. (Anime adaptation of one of the best arcs in the manga? Hell yeah!) And then, unless something else catches my eye that just can't wait, I'll watch DR3: Future.
